Waltz’s admission contradicts what President Trump has said in his defense of Waltz. Trump claimed that “It was one of Michael’s people on the phone. A staffer had his number on there.” Waltz confirmed the account provided by Goldberg, saying during the interview “Look, a staffer wasn’t responsible. I take full responsibility.” Chris Cameron March 25, 2025, 7:17 p.m. ET46 minutes ago Chris Cameron Michael Waltz, President Trump’s national security adviser, said in an appearance on Fox News that “I take full responsibility” for the sharing of military plans on the messaging app Signal, adding that he had “built the group” and added the journalist Jeffrey Goldberg to it. |

The White House confirmed Mr. Goldberg’s account. But Mr. Hegseth later denied that he put war plans in the group chat, which apparently included other senior members of Mr. Trump’s national security team. In disclosing the aircraft, targets and timing for hitting Houthi militia sites in Yemen on the commercial messaging app Signal, Mr. Hegseth risked the lives of American war fighters. Across the military on Monday and Tuesday, current and retired troops and officers expressed dismay and anger in social media posts, secret chat groups and the hallways of the Pentagon. My father was killed in action flying night-trail interdiction over the Ho Chi Minh Trail” after a North Vietnamese strike, said the retired Maj. Gen. Paul D. Eaton, who served in the Iraq war. “And now, you have Hegseth. He has released information that could have directly led to the death of an American fighter pilot.” |
